**Vendor note: Inkmill markdown pipeline**

Rendering for Parchway docs is outsourced to Inkmill under an annual contract, renewing each March. They handle sanitization and PDF export; we own the upload queue. SLA: 4-hour response on rendering failures. Escalate only after two failed retries. Their support desk is reachable at the address below.

billing contact of hahaf-baguf = zorael.tammir.jorius@sivrelhq.internal

## Deployment

Quick note before you deploy Taxlee: the rate-lookup cache is warmed from the nightly snapshot, so a cold deploy mid-day means slow lookups for a few minutes — totally normal. Just don't shrink the TTL without asking first. The cache layer in staging runs with the following settings.

deployment values, bagug-yagep:
zorwyn:
  log_level: error
  metrics_host: metrics.zorwyn.zemvarlabs.internal
  pool_size: 8

Handover note — Crumbwheel order cutoffs.

Welcome aboard. The bakery cutoff rule in Crumbwheel closes same-day orders at 14:00 local to each storefront, not UTC — this has bitten us twice. Holiday overrides live in the calendar service and take precedence silently, so always check there first when a cutoff looks wrong. To unlock the calendar service's admin console after a restart, enter the recovery passphrase below.

vault phrase of bagap-bahaf = silion-pelox-sorox-casdor-quenwyn-fraax-eliox-praael-kelion-quenvan-kasox-rusael-norius-belvan